Online auction websites are useful when fixed pricing does not match the way buyers value a product.
They work well for rare items, clearance stock, charity sales, supplier bidding, limited drops, and marketplace selling.
The main challenge is choosing the right way to build it.
Many store owners are not sure how to create an auction website, which auction type fits their business, or whether they need a custom platform.
With WooCommerce and a WooCommerce auction plugin, you can create a publish-ready auction website much faster.
A basic setup can be ready within a day or two if hosting, theme, payment, and product details are already planned.
In this guide, you will learn how to create an online auction website with WooCommerce, use one setup for multiple auction types, and match each auction model with real business scenarios.
We will also cover the key features needed to manage bids, winners, payments, and auction rules.
If you want to build a WooCommerce auction marketplace, the same setup can be extended with a WooCommerce marketplace plugin.
Create a Publish-Ready Auction Website with WooCommerce

WooCommerce gives you the base to sell products online. It manages products, customers, checkout, orders, taxes, shipping, and payment flow.
To run auctions, your store also needs bidding, auction timers, bid increments, reserve price, auction status, winner handling, and payment reminders.
An auction plugin for WooCommerce adds these features inside your existing store. You do not need to build a custom auction platform from the start.
This makes WooCommerce a practical choice for a WordPress auction website, especially when you want to launch quickly and still keep room for future changes.
Steps to Set Up an Auction Website with WooCommerce
The setup should start with a stable WooCommerce base. After that, the auction plugin can handle bidding, auction rules, and winner management.
1. Choose Hosting Built for Auction Traffic
Auction pages need fast server response times because users watch timers, place bids, and refresh bid activity often. Slow hosting can hurt the bidding experience.
Look for hosting with SSD or NVMe storage, enough PHP workers, object caching such as Redis, and good database performance. For busy auctions, this matters more than a basic shared plan.
You should also use caching carefully. Static pages can be cached, but live bid areas, cart, checkout, and account pages should not show stale data.
For a faster start, you can use a ready server image or managed setup. Webkul can support Apache or Nginx-based AWS image options for WordPress and WooCommerce stores.
2. Install WordPress and WooCommerce
After the server is ready, install WordPress and WooCommerce. Set up currency, payment methods, tax, shipping, customer accounts, and basic store pages.
This gives your site the normal eCommerce flow. Buyers can register, view products, bid on items, win auctions, and pay through WooCommerce checkout.
3. Pick a WooCommerce-Compatible Theme
You can start with the default WooCommerce theme or choose a theme that fits your auction category. The design should keep bids, price, timer, and product details easy to read.
An antique auction may need a clean catalog layout. A limited product drop may need a faster, modern layout with strong product images and clear action buttons.
You can also check the Shoplix WooCommerce Theme, which is fully compatible with Auction plugin.
4. Add the WooCommerce Auction Plugin
Once WooCommerce is ready, install the WooCommerce Auction add-on. It adds auction product types, bidding rules, countdown timers, auction status, and winner handling.
You can then create auction products, choose the auction type, set the starting price, add reserve price, define bid increments, and decide the auction duration.
5. Test Before You Publish
Before the first live auction, test the full flow with a low-value product. Check bid placement, outbid emails, countdown behavior, winner selection, payment, and order creation.
For full module settings, follow the WooCommerce auction plugin documentation. The blog should guide the launch plan, while the docs should guide detailed configuration.
Business Scenarios and Best Auction Models
An online auction website is not limited to one type of product. The same setup can support many business cases if you choose the right auction model.
| Business scenario | Best auction model | Why it fits |
|---|---|---|
| Collectibles and antiques | Standard auction, reserve auction | Buyers compete based on rarity and demand. |
| Clearance and liquidation | Standard auction, no-reserve auction | Stores can move old or excess stock faster. |
| Charity and fundraising | Charity auction, silent auction | Donors can bid on items, services, or experiences. |
| B2B procurement | Reverse auction | Suppliers compete by offering lower prices. |
| Limited product drops | Standard auction, seated auction | Brands can manage demand for limited items. |
| Art, vehicle, and event lots | Event-based auction | Many lots can be grouped under one sale event. |
| Marketplace selling | Vendor auction model | Multiple sellers can list auction products. |
Collectibles and Antique Auctions
Rare products often have flexible value. Coins, antiques, signed items, art pieces, and collectibles can attract different bids from different buyers.
A standard auction lets demand decide the final price. A reserve price helps the seller avoid selling below a safe minimum value.
Liquidation and Clearance Sales
Retailers can use auctions to sell old stock, returned goods, seasonal products, or excess inventory.
A no-reserve auction can bring faster buyer action when the main goal is stock movement instead of fixed-margin selling.
Charity and Fundraising Auctions
Charity groups, NGOs, schools, clubs, and communities can run fundraising auctions for products, services, tickets, or sponsored experiences.
Silent auctions can keep bids private, while charity auctions can help increase donor interest during a campaign or event.
B2B Reverse Auctions
A reverse auction helps buyers collect lower bids from suppliers. It fits procurement, vendor selection, bulk buying, and service contracts.
For example, a company can invite suppliers to bid for a supply deal. The buyer can then choose the best offer based on price and terms.
Limited Product Drops
Brands can use auctions when demand is higher than available stock. This can apply to limited editions, special releases, or premium items.
A seated auction can limit access to approved buyers or members. It keeps the event more controlled and can create a better buyer experience.
Vendor-Based Auction Marketplace
If many sellers need to list auction products, you can create an auction marketplace with WooCommerce and a compatible marketplace plugin.
This path fits antique marketplaces, local seller portals, B2B sourcing platforms, art communities, and niche multi-vendor auction websites.
Auction Types to Use in This Setup
Different auction types support different goals. With one WooCommerce auction setup, you can run many selling models without creating separate websites.
- Standard auction: Buyers place higher bids, and the highest bidder wins when the auction ends.
- Reverse auction: Suppliers or sellers place lower bids, often for procurement or B2B buying.
- Sealed auction: Bids stay hidden until the auction ends, which helps with private or high-value sales.
- Silent auction: Buyers bid privately, often for charity, events, or restricted groups.
- Proxy bidding: Buyers set a maximum bid, and the system bids up to that limit.
- Absentee bidding: Buyers can place bids when they cannot stay active during the live auction.
- Dutch auction: The price drops until a buyer accepts it.
- Penny auction: Each bid raises the price by a small amount.
- No-reserve auction: The product can sell without a minimum reserve price.
- Unique bid auction: The winning rule depends on a unique bid pattern.
- Charity auction: The auction supports fundraising or donation-based selling.
Key Features Needed for an Online Bidding Website
A strong online bidding website should help buyers act with confidence and help the store owner manage auctions without manual follow-up.
- Real-time bidding: Shows updated bid value, price, and auction status without forcing users to refresh the page.
- Countdown timer: Helps buyers understand how much time is left before bidding closes.
- Proxy bidding: Lets buyers set their maximum bid and stay active even when they are not online.
- Absentee bidding: Allows users to place bids before the auction starts or when they cannot join live.
- Reserve price: Protects the seller by setting the minimum acceptable selling price.
- Bid increments: Keeps the bidding process clean by defining how much each new bid should increase.
- Buy now price: Gives buyers a direct purchase option when instant sale is allowed.
- Anti-sniping: Extends auction time when a bid is placed near the end, so other bidders can respond.
- Wallet payments: Helps frequent bidders pay faster where wallet flow is enabled.
- Winner checkout: Lets the winning buyer complete payment through WooCommerce checkout.
- Email notifications: Sends alerts for bids, outbid status, wins, losses, reminders, and payment actions.
- Buyer dashboard: Lets users track active bids, won auctions, lost auctions, and payment status.
- Watchlist: Allows buyers to save auctions and return before the bidding ends.
Benefits of Using Webkul WooCommerce Auction Plugin
Many basic auction plugins focus only on adding a bid option to products.
A real auction website needs more than that. It needs auction types, payment flow, buyer tools, admin control, and trust features.
Webkul WooCommerce Auction Plugin brings many of these features in one setup. This helps store owners run different auction models without depending on several separate tools.
- 11 auction types: You can run standard, reverse, sealed, proxy, penny, Dutch, unique bid, seated, silent, no-reserve, and charity auctions from one WooCommerce setup.
- Built-in wallet support: Users can add wallet balance and use it for auction payments where enabled. This can help reduce payment delays after a buyer wins an auction.
- WooCommerce checkout and gateway support: Winners can complete payment through the normal WooCommerce checkout flow. The store can use payment gateways supported by WooCommerce.
- Proxy and absentee bidding: Buyers can set a maximum bid or place bids when they cannot stay active during the auction. This helps increase participation from serious buyers.
- Anti-sniping protection: The auction time can extend when a bid is placed near closing. This gives other bidders a fair chance to respond.
- Reserve price and bid increment rules: Store owners can set starting bid, reserve price, buy now price, and bid increments. This helps protect product value and keeps bidding clear.
- Real-time bidding experience: Buyers can see updated bids, price, and countdown changes without refreshing the page.
- Buyer dashboard and watchlist: Users can track active bids, won auctions, lost auctions, saved auctions, and payment status from their account area.
- Auction notifications: The plugin can send alerts for bid activity, outbid status, auction wins, losses, reminders, relists, and payment actions.
- Admin auction management: Store owners can manage bids, winners, auction status, relists, bid logs, and reports from the backend.
- Security and audit features: Bid validation, activity logs, bidder masking, and fraud checks help improve trust during live auctions.
- Marketplace extension: If the business needs multiple vendors, the auction setup can be extended with a compatible WooCommerce marketplace plugin.
Build an Auction Marketplace with WooCommerce
A single-seller auction site is enough when one store owner manages all products. This fits brands, charities, retailers, and auction houses.
A marketplace is better when many sellers need to list and manage their own auction products. In that case, the auction setup can be extended with a marketplace plugin.
A WooCommerce auction marketplace can support vendor products, seller listings, commission flow, auction management, and multi-seller bidding activity.
This model fits niche auction platforms, antique seller networks, local product portals, B2B sourcing websites, and multi-vendor auction websites.
Launch Faster with Hosting, Theme, and Setup Support
Some businesses can launch with the plugin and documentation. Others may need help with hosting, server setup, theme setup, payment flow, or custom auction rules.
Webkul offers complete WooCommerce development services to help businesses launch with WooCommerce products, server setup, theme setup, and marketplace setup.
For example, a business may need a server setup, auction plugin installation, custom design changes, or a special vendor workflow.
This end-to-end support can save time when the goal is to publish quickly and avoid delays in technical setup, design, or custom development.
When Auctions Beat Fixed Pricing
An auction model is a better choice when product value depends on demand, rarity, urgency, or buyer competition.
Fixed pricing works for regular products. Auctions are stronger for rare products, limited stock, charity items, supplier bidding, and products where buyers may pay different values.
If your store already runs on WooCommerce, adding auction features is usually faster than building a custom online bidding platform from scratch.
Start Building Your Auction Website
Creating an online auction website with WooCommerce is a practical path for many businesses. You can start with a normal store and add bidding features through a plugin.
The same setup can support collectibles, liquidation sales, charity auctions, reverse bidding, product drops, event auctions, and marketplace selling.
If you want to launch faster, Webkul WooCommerce Auction Plugin can help you add auction types, real-time bidding, payment flow, winner checkout, and auction management to your store.
For full configuration, use the module documentation and set up the plugin based on your auction model, payment flow, and business needs.
Yes. You can create an online auction website with WooCommerce by adding an auction plugin. It adds bidding, timers, auction rules, winner handling, and payment flow to your store.
Not always. If your business can use WooCommerce checkout, products, users, and payment gateways, Webkul auction plugin can be a faster and lower-effort option.
It can support collectibles, antiques, clearance stock, charity items, limited products, art, vehicles, B2B procurement deals, and vendor-listed products.
Yes. One setup can support models such as standard auction, reverse auction, sealed auction, proxy bidding, silent auction, and charity auction.
Yes. If you want vendors to list auction products, you can extend the setup with a compatible WooCommerce marketplace plugin.
An auction website can be made publish-ready within a day or two if hosting, theme, payment, products, and basic setup details are ready.

Be the first to comment.